As uncomfortable as it was, the rag-tag team dispersed after their tea with the enemy. Or is he even the enemy anymore? It is hard to say; the situation is complicated to the point of absurdity. But … at least for Xander Lightfoot, he didn't have too much time to think on it. Instead, he was sent to see the castle doctor. There he was declared to only have a minor head injury. A poultice made from willow bark was applied to the injured spot and a clean bandage wrapped around his head to keep it in place. He was also given several strips of the bark to chew to help with his headache. On his way back to the tea room, Xander learned that Umeko had withdrawn to a nearby sitting room. The others had retired to bedrooms. And Vandringar … well, where he has gone is unknown. Since the sitting room was only a few steps down the hall, Xander couldn't help but stick his head in.

Sitting Room
It's dark and quiet here. The peaceful feeling is broken by a flicker… a fitful violet light diffused into murky patches of varying density. Darkness again, followed by the roll of thunder. The rushing sound of rain falling against the glass soon follows as the momentary lapse in the storm has subsided. The only other light in the room is a warm yellow glow from a well-burned candle resting upon a table near the window. It dimly illuminates the circular room, a wine-red rug laid across the floor.

"Umeko?" the Lapi calls out quietly.

Another flash of lightning and Xander can make out a shadowy shape sitting on the sill before the large glass window. The same is definitely Umeko, but she is so motionless it almost seems more like a stature than the reptile Xander has come to know well. Her long sword has been drawn from her belt and the butt of it rests against the corner of the window frame. It stretches back to Umeko and there she rests with her chin upon its butt. "Are you feeling better?" she answers to the call.

"Err, a bit," Xander says, approaching cautiously. "Are you alright? I've never seen you use your sword like that before."

"As a chin rest?" Umeko asks with a hint of amusement in her voice. With lazy grace, she sits back and lifts her sword from the window frame and leans it against the wall. "I am fine. Just … thinking. A terrible habit."

"You always seem to treat your swords with a lot of respect is all," Xander explains, walking to the windowsill. "It surprised me. What are you thinking about?"

"The situation we're in. I am sorry for dragging you into this. I should have let you go home instead of hiring you as my adviser," the Kiriga explains. Her head cants slightly to the side and she looks out into the rainy night.

"Sorry?" Xander asks, sounding a bit shocked. "Am I not living up to your expectations, Umeko?"

Umeko shakes her head. "No, no, nothing like that," she says. "I know you are not a fighter and do not expect such from you. It just. It is." There's a sigh from the Kiriga as she finally says, "I don't like seeing you hurt."

"Well, we have that in common!" Xander says, smiling to show he's trying to be humorous. "But, I am a fire mage. I'd be doing something dangerous whether I was with you or not, and frankly I'm glad I've been with you, or you could have gotten hurt yourself!"

"Instead I've just been changed into a monster and had some teeth fall out," Umeko replies … though there is thankfully a hint of humor in her voice too. "I still feel like a monster in these lands, too. There is no one like me here in either appearance or culture."

"Well, that happens when you travel outside of the big cities," Xander notes. "Kiriga are still pretty rare outside of Jadai, I think. I saw some up on Caroban, of course, but they were there looking to hire."

"Mm. I would not be surprised if I knew them," Umeko notes the Kiriga reaches up and cuts a delicate line in the mist of her breath that has collected upon the cold glass. "I am sorry for yelling at you earlier," she says in a near whisper.

"Well, you were upset," Xander notes. "Apology accepted. How are you feeling now? Need warming up? Oh… and what did you want to talk to me about?"

"I am all right; the temperature in here is … tolerable. As for talking, well, just that mainly," Umeko explains, the Kiriga still looking out the window. "I am sorry I am not a very good … what is the term in your language … girlfriend?"

Xander's ears shoot up, making him wince slightly since it pulls on the bandage. "Girlfriend? You mean… " he starts to say, then pauses. "I'm not a very good boyfriend then, since I haven't really taken you out on a date yet! Or brought you flowers and xocholatl. Err. Can Kiriga eat xocholatl?"

"And I have taken you into a den where the Mistress of the Castle tears people apart and drinks their fluids," Umeko has to point out. She shifts a bit and pats the spot on the sill next to her, adding, "And of course we can."

"Oh good! Although I don't think I can get any here," Xander says. "And the Raveness isn't as scary as some women I've met. Err, not that I find you scary or anything!"

Umeko rolls her head so that she's back to looking at Xander. "Yes, you do," the Kiriga says simply. "I'm all fangs, claws, and other … pointy parts."

"Well, those make you more… exciting," Xander admits, with a grin. "But the way you play with me sometimes is a little scary, but in a good way."

"See, you enjoy scary," the Kiriga says … almost smugly, really. "Of course, it may not matter. I do not yet see how we are to escape this prison. If the only solution is the Lord of the castle, it is unlikely we will find anything about him here."

"Well, what I mean is … about his disappearance," Umeko clarifies.

"Oh, I'm sure there are other solutions," Xander notes. "There must be a way to use the stones to contain the Void, if that… Observer? Well, that bug thing had a way to do it, right?"

"Perhaps. I think the Raveness is effectively that 'bug thing' now, given both kill gruesomely," Umeko notes. "Did that hunter tell you much? Anything even small might be a clue."

"I didn't get a chance to really talk to her much about that," Xander says. "I got her tell me about Vandringar going with the Murder, and was busy trying to convince her to not go after Lilac the rest of the time."

"Well, that is a futile effort. Which ultimately means either she succeeds in killing Lilac, or we succeed in killing her," Umeko notes, "That is, if we ever escape this place."

"Maybe Gibson can get through to her," Xander notes. "And once we figure out what Lilac's connection to the Raveness is, we'll be closer to get out of here."

"Mm, perhaps," Umeko agrees, though without much conviction in her voice. "I still do not see how Lilac would have any association… " The Kiriga sits up, webbed ears perking, "Well, unless… I wonder."

"The Raveness thinks she does, and so does the tapestry," Xander notes. "So there's something… What?"

"Maybe Lilac found Lord Rook. Or rather, what happened to him. Perhaps that discovery alerted the Raveness and formed the connection," Umeko suggests.

"I thought something like that might have happened, since the curse is different for her, and she hadn't been here before," Xander says. "And you both had that dream. She may have been onto something with the idea of you two being the last vestiges of the Temple of Being. Touched by the orb's power and whatnot."

"She meant herself and the orb, not me," Umeko clarifies as she finally slips off the window sill. "I'm nothing of importance in this. Just a strange foreigner."

Xander shakes his head, and says, "The orb isn't here, so she meant you." Then he reaches out to brush the side of Umeko's mouth. "Your fangs came in after you'd been returned to your normal form. The power was still active in you for that to happen. There may still be some left inside you."

Umeko chuckles in that strange, hissing, way of hers. "Maybe I'll change back into that … thing," she jokes. Still, she can't help but press her tongue against those odd bulges in the roof of her mouth, causing a small trickle of yellowish fluid to drip down one fang. Her long tail curls lightly around Xander's leg. "Would you still find me attractive if I did?" she murmurs … those sharp teeth of hers lightly touching the Lapi's ear.

Xander jumps a little, as usual. "Well, if it was still you inside," he says, "then probably, yes."

"Part of me wishes I could have seen myself like that. It must have been very … odd," Umeko says.

"Well, the changing was a bit disturbing, but the form itself was… " Here the Lapi pauses to think of the proper term. "Majestic. And scary. Majestic and scary."

"You sound as if you liked it," Umeko comments and takes a moment to tap a claw tip against the Lapi's twitching nose.

"I… try to enjoy life," Xander admits, and rubs his nose. "You'd probably like seeing me change into a big blue Kiriga, I bet."

"I … would not complain. But such is unlikely," Umeko comments, the corners of her lips twitching in amusement. There the Kiriga drapes her arm lightly around the Lapi's shoulders. "Do you believe that Vandringar is trustworthy for the moment? I must admit I would … prefer to introduce him to Grey Cloud more so than ally with him."

"Trustworthy?" Xander asks, both eyebrows crawling up his scalp. "Whether he is worthy of trust or not, I'm not going to trust him to have our best interests at heart."

"Indeed," Umeko has to agree. "Where do you think we should begin investigating this? I was considering the library, in hopes that writing has preserved some of the memories our hosts have lost."

"I should take a closer look at that tapestry, and sweep the castle for more magical artifacts," Xander notes, scratching at the unbandaged side of his face. "And I'd like to inspect the barrier… or whatever it is… surrounding the Rookery. And also get a bath if possible. Dried swamp water is nearly as bad as the wet version."

"Do you wish me to bathe you?" Umeko offers, "Since you have helped me in the past. As for the tapestry, that is a good thought as well. In truth, I feel rather … useless here. I cannot fight due to the rules, I know not magic, I lack Lilac's abilities and I do not have a stone like Anisa. It feels as if my best ability is … well, if it came down to it, to buy you time as a sacrifice."

"Well, you can talk to the staff for me," Xander suggests. "I'm not entirely sure anybody here is still technically alive. We need to know if anyone has died of natural causes or if there have been any births since the Rookery was sealed off."

"My guess is there have been no births. They do not even know what the passage of time has been," Umeko says, "They are … somehow stuck, I believe. Non-existence."

"There is something we do need Vandringar for, I think," Xander says. "Or might… "

"Which is? And if you tell me you wish me to … flirt with him I will bite you," Umeko warns.

"Nothing like that!" Xander says, holding up his hands. "It's just… well… I don't know the whole story here, and should probably ask Anisa what she thinks… but it seems that Vandringar was missing for years or something inside the place where these orbs where created, right?"

"Did Anisa say she was where they were made? I thought it was just a related location," Umeko admits. "You think he knows more than he is saying, then?"

"Yes, he doesn't seem the type to come here without a plan," Xander says. "My concern is that if the Void orb has to exist within someone in order for us to leave, and that someone is very likely to be Lilac, then he probably knows how to remove it from her before she becomes completely hollowed out like the Raveness."

"Except there is a flaw in that plan. Lilac is already carrying something," Umeko feels compelled to point out. "I know they ordered us not to fight … but perhaps it is worth dying if I manage to break his neck before the Murder tears me apart… "

"That's right, Lilac is carrying the children of the Temple of Being," Xander notes. "Which is why I think she could carry the Void as well, if the two really are complementary and will cancel one another out for a time."

"Or me, if your suggestion that I may carry latent effects of the orb of being," Umeko adds and shakes her head. "I do not wish either of us to be like the Raveness."

"If I might suggest… well, hmm," Xander says, looking worried now. "We can't let on that Lilac is pregnant. But Vandringar already knows you were exposed to the orb's power. Maybe you could mention the fangs and venom to him, since he sure knew enough about the orb to get it to do all of that stuff before. You're a noble, highly placed in the Empire now, so… well, you'd be a good recruit for his secret order, wouldn't you?"

"You wish to see if he'll try to recruit me?" Umeko asks, her scaly brow arching high. "Xander Lightfoot, that is most disturbed. Also unlikely, given he thinks little of women from what I have heard."

"That attitude may not apply to reptilian women," Xander points out. "The point is that you are the only one of us who has a real chance of getting close to him and getting answers. How he reacts to learning about your mutation would be really telling too."

"So, should I try to arrange a private conversation with him then?" Umeko asks as she looks back towards the rain battered window. "And see what he knew or expected of the orb. Would he even believe that? I am not sure how I would mention things without sounding obviously … false."

"He won't trust you anyway, but like he says, it's all part of the 'game'," Xander notes. "You're a noble though, so he has to treat you as an equal. Plus… well, you wanted something to do anyway!"

"Will you defend my honor if he flirts with me?" Umeko asks Xander and even bats her eyes at him.

"Of course!" Xander says, puffing out his chest and pressing a fist to it. "So long as I can use fireballs, anyway. And if you do feel like you're succumbing to his charms… err… come get me and I'll snap you right out of it!"

"Besides, he probably assumes I'm with Anisa," the Lapi points out.

Umeko actually snorts a laugh. "Perhaps, perhaps," she finally manages to say. "Still these are good suggestions to pursue. Of course … something else to bear in mind… If I do have any residual effects from the orb, it could be possible that those necklaces they wear could affect me."

"Well… I don't see how they could," Xander notes, thoughtfully. "The orb would be able to affect you, and they could affect the orb… "

"And they can't affect the void orb currently, so … " Umeko says, then shakes her head, "Thoughts for another time." She tugs on Xander and walks towards the door, adding, "Now, come. Let's get you your bath."

"Yeah, we should look good for the feast!" Xander says, following along and wagging his little puff-tail.
